Residential & Dining Enterprises (R&DE), the largest auxiliary organization at Stanford University, supports the academic mission of the university by providing high-quality services to students and other members of the university community. R&DE has an annual operating budget of $400M, operates 24/7/365, and oversees a $3B asset portfolio comprising over 7 million square feet-one-third of the campus footprint. R&DE provides housing for 16,000 students and dependents, serves 8 million meals annually at 48 student dining venues and 32 culinary enterprises. In addition, R&DE provides executive services, conference operations, and guest lodging. R&DE is a talented and diverse team of 1,200+ who comprise the following divisions: Student Housing Operations & Stanford Conferences; Stanford Dining and Hospitality & Auxiliaries; Maintenance Operations and Capital Projects; and a team of R&DE strategic business partners-Finance & Administration, Information Technology, Human Resources, and Strategic Communications and Marketing.

JOB PURPOSE
Employees at this classification carry out a variety of food preparation and/or catering tasks including cooking a variety of hot foods, sauces, and casseroles and may bake and prepare desserts. In large dining halls, they may prepare selected menu items designated by a higher-level worker or supervisor. Food is prepared from standardized recipes and general instructions but are responsible for the correct portioning, seasoning and timing on the items they prepare. May be responsible for the efficient operation and maintenance of a dining hall storeroom and coordinate the work of at least two other workers in a large dining hall. May review daily menus with supervisors, determine work priorities within menu guidelines, assign specific daily duties to other workers. Employees at this level do not have supervisory authority over other employees and are not expected to exercise independent judgment on final decisions regarding quality or quantity of work produced by such employees, or personnel actions such as hiring, promotion, discharge or disciplinary measures.
CORE DUTIES
Prepare hot foods including entrees, vegetables, starches, sauces, and gravies · In a small dining hall, may prepare all menu items
Coordinates work of helpers
Orders supplies from storeroom as needed
Stores and records leftovers and discusses use with supervisor.
Receives, marks, records and verifies deliveries against orders, reports discrepancies to management
Within guidelines set by management, determines the most efficient shelving system and storage method and stores stock. Rotates stock.
Fills requisitions submitted by food service workers and management, records items issued and submits records to management.
Prepares tallies of stock received and issued
Conducts periodic inventories with a supervisor. Informs management of items that need to be reordered and items that need to be used
Gathers counts and bags laundry for pick-up, issues clean linen
May serve prepared food and beverages (non-alcoholic and alcoholic beverages.)
May make deliveries to other dining halls that require driving a truck
May perform any of the duties described in the Food Services Worker III specification or other duties as assigned.
Adhere to safety rules.
